Description of contents: programme
1. Definition of marketing in Social Networks, benefits, platforms. Create an online community. Monitoring and optimization of the presence in Social Networks (control and decision making tables, Social Media Engagement, Measurement of Return on Investment). 2. Content marketing: to identify business opportunities and establish marketing strategies through comments, conversations and recommendations from the consumers themselves from social networking sites (such as facebook.com, twitter.com, etc., or own e-commerce platforms as amazon.com, expedia.com). 3. Direct digital marketing (DDM) (such emailing, cellphone text messaging as SMS and WhatsApp) 4. Native advertising
